You have a full-time job and you are also doing a part-time evening course.
You now find that you cannot continue the course.
Write a letter to your teachers. In your letter
describe the situation
explain why you cannot continue at this time
say what action you would like to take
Dear Mrs. Smith,
I am writing this letter to inform you that I will have to discontinue my part-time web designers’ course. I am afraid, I shall not be able to complete this course, as I am moving to another country next month.
My company has expanded to another international market, in Canada. I am offered a desirable job profile and an excellent opportunity to manage a new team in Toronto. I am thrilled to have received this promotion and wish to go ahead with the same.
Having said that, I understand that distance learning is not an option and I am forced to quit my computing sessions with you, immediately. I would have liked to attend all my upcoming classes, however, I am expected to prepare and leave for Canada at the earliest.
I would like you to know that I incredibly admire your teaching methods and look up to your speaking skills. I request you to kindly acknowledge my dismissal from this institute. Furthermore, I will be highly obliged if you could assist me with a withdrawal application to retrieve my next term fee.
Additionally, I would appreciate if you could help me donate my set of books and notes to a to a deserving student at the academy. Hoping for a quick and favorable response.
Thank you.
Yours sincerely,
Kathy Kay
